Quarterly Planning Note — Divestiture of the Coastal Tooling Unit

For the finance team: the sale of the Coastal Tooling unit to Pellmark Industries remains on track for close in Q3. Please finalize the carve-out balance sheet, reconcile intercompany positions, and prepare the working-capital adjustment schedule by month-end. Audit support requests should be prioritized. For planning purposes, note the following sensitive item:

internal memo for hawef-kahif: The finance team signed off on a budget of $25.9 million for Project Sorox. The renewal with Pelokek Logistics closes at $51.7 million a year, 52 percent below the last contract.

Handover note — Priya to Calder, Ordwell service. Soft deletes on the orders table are implemented via a deleted_at column; rows are excluded by a default query scope, not removed. Purge jobs run nightly and respect the retention window. Please verify that audit reads bypass the scope intentionally. The relevant configuration values as deployed are listed below.

config for kafof-bawef:
holath:
  log_level: debug
  metrics_host: metrics.holath.qorvelsys.internal
  pin: 2191
  pool_size: 32

# Catalog Cache Invalidation: Limits and Quotas

The Marrowfield product catalog invalidates cache entries through the Spindlet event bus. Each merchant change emits an invalidation message, and the cache layer coalesces bursts per SKU to avoid stampedes. On-call note: if the invalidation queue depth exceeds the alert threshold, check for a bulk import before scaling consumers. Per-tenant quotas prevent one merchant from flushing the whole cache. Current operational limits are set as follows.

tuning table, bajef-tajop:
QUOTAS = {
    "siliel": 447,
    "quenax": 542,
    "framir": 222,
    "sorix": 913,
    "silion": 166,
}